• Home
  • Raw
  • Download

Lines Matching refs:program

868 	struct vidtv_psi_table_pat_program *program;  in vidtv_psi_pat_program_init()  local
871 program = kzalloc(sizeof(*program), GFP_KERNEL); in vidtv_psi_pat_program_init()
872 if (!program) in vidtv_psi_pat_program_init()
875 program->service_id = cpu_to_be16(service_id); in vidtv_psi_pat_program_init()
878 program->bitfield = cpu_to_be16((RESERVED << 13) | program_map_pid); in vidtv_psi_pat_program_init()
879 program->next = NULL; in vidtv_psi_pat_program_init()
885 head->next = program; in vidtv_psi_pat_program_init()
888 return program; in vidtv_psi_pat_program_init()
909 struct vidtv_psi_table_pat_program *program; in vidtv_psi_pat_program_assign() local
914 program = p; in vidtv_psi_pat_program_assign()
916 if (p == pat->program) in vidtv_psi_pat_program_assign()
919 while (program) { in vidtv_psi_pat_program_assign()
921 program = program->next; in vidtv_psi_pat_program_assign()
925 pat->program = p; in vidtv_psi_pat_program_assign()
966 struct vidtv_psi_table_pat_program *p = args->pat->program; in vidtv_psi_pat_write_into()
1028 vidtv_psi_pat_program_destroy(p->program); in vidtv_psi_pat_table_destroy()
1101 struct vidtv_psi_table_pat_program *program = pat->program; in vidtv_psi_pmt_get_pid() local
1108 while (program) { in vidtv_psi_pmt_get_pid()
1109 if (program->service_id == section->header.id) in vidtv_psi_pmt_get_pid()
1110 return vidtv_psi_get_pat_program_pid(program); in vidtv_psi_pmt_get_pid()
1112 program = program->next; in vidtv_psi_pmt_get_pid()
1484 struct vidtv_psi_table_pat_program *program; in vidtv_psi_pmt_create_sec_for_each_pat_entry() local
1492 program = pat->program; in vidtv_psi_pmt_create_sec_for_each_pat_entry()
1493 while (program) { in vidtv_psi_pmt_create_sec_for_each_pat_entry()
1494 if (program->service_id) in vidtv_psi_pmt_create_sec_for_each_pat_entry()
1496 program = program->next; in vidtv_psi_pmt_create_sec_for_each_pat_entry()
1505 for (program = pat->program; program; program = program->next) { in vidtv_psi_pmt_create_sec_for_each_pat_entry()
1506 if (!program->service_id) in vidtv_psi_pmt_create_sec_for_each_pat_entry()
1508 pmt_secs[i] = vidtv_psi_pmt_table_init(be16_to_cpu(program->service_id), in vidtv_psi_pmt_create_sec_for_each_pat_entry()